The value of k translates the graph vertically (upwards or downwards)

The given equation is:

y   =  ab(x   -  h)   +   k

Let the equation before k was added be y₀

That is, y₀ =  ab(x  -  h)

The equation can therefore be written as:

y  =  y₀  +  k

The value of k is a vertical translation of y₀. It can either be shifted up or down depending on whether the value of k is positive or negative.
